Transaction 51dd7456e9357f13a56a54ef28035fb8a7f3b2099de69049c5488f3ac43b254b
1 Input
1 Output
-
51dd7456e9357f13a56a54ef28035fb8a7f3b2099de69049c5488f3ac43b254b:0
- value
- 64547195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a2993bc25fa583f846d9cf6e34bf152be78e725 OP_EQUAL
- address
- 3EHYyqrjQuuRj6gdNShTE7AJmawfu4hS2E